Privacy by Design

Built-in safeguards, with multi-level anonymisation ensures powerful and compliant privacy solutions.

All TRU Recognition Platform functions are safeguarded with compliance to the Australian Privacy Principles (APPs), the Australian Privacy Act 1988 and the majority of GDPR requirements. TRU Recognition does not use or store personally identifiable information (PII)within datasets except to comply with legal requirements. Our privacy policy describes how we collect, use, disclose, store, secure and dispose of data in detail.

TRU Recognition’s anonymisation design principle enables clients to balance data insights with compliance and governance requirements. The TRU Recognition Platform provides four levels of personally identifiable information (PII) redaction – face blurring, body blurring, ghosting (body segmentation and redaction), and avatar creation in a virtual digital twin. Each form of anonymisation is customisable.

Ethics by Design

We identify and mitigate ethical risks, directing technology development in a thoroughly ethical manner.

TRU Recognition is dedicated to creating ethical real-world solutions that deliver value from data. The world-leading ethical AI organisation Gradient Institute is partnering with us to provide best-practice AI model validation. Criteria, such as accuracy, how the technology functions in specific contexts, customisation, configuration and bias evaluation are some of the foci of our validation.

TRU Recognition has a mature process and framework for systematically identifying and mitigating ethical risks associated with operationalising AI-driven analytics for specific use cases. Our Digital Ethics Framework is an evolution of the framework created by global experts Frank Buytendijk, Svetlana Sicular and Jitendra Subramanyam. It goes beyond the question of what is within legal boundaries to understand the elements of moral and conscious decision-making when deploying our technology. Our principles guide the deliberation process to monitor for unintended consequences, allowing us to actively direct technology development in an ethical manner.

Our technology partners across our supply chain are assessed from a privacy and ethics perspective in relation to local regulatory requirements before integration onto the Platform.We can also assist clients in understanding the privacy and ethical considerations that may be relevant to the use of specific applications on our platform.
